Change since 2011 is not available for this village.
The 2020 Mission Antyodaya survey recorded a population of 1,002
— exactly the Census 2011 figure. That happens in about 15% of villages
nationally, where the surveyor appears to have carried the old number forward
rather than counting afresh. Showing “0% growth” here would be
reporting a number nobody measured, so we don't.

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25
XV Finance Commission grant for
Chakundapal panchayat, Patana zila parishad.
These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at
hol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village
sp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.
Opening balance
₹31.12 lakh
Received from state (auto-transfer)
₹16.32 lakh
Received directly
₹80,810
Spent
₹14.82 lakh
Unspent at year end
₹33.43 lakh
Untied (basic grant)
opened ₹22.55 lakh · received ₹6.53 lakh · spent ₹7.67 lakh · left ₹22.21 lakh
Tied (earmarked)
opened ₹8.57 lakh · received ₹9.79 lakh · spent ₹7.15 lakh · left ₹11.22 lakh
Source: eGramSwaraj, as reported by the panchayat. Untied and tied
together make up the totals above.
